Output 5642a0e8914fe06504c683bdb5adcc9b2a58ad019a2d16b669483e5780680244:0

value
2899000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40c0ea174d3c217c987aecb30da3a71dbce4d535 OP_EQUAL
address
37bQGkS67h45bbLhdkS7Bb4gVWEyoCrr7R
transaction
5642a0e8914fe06504c683bdb5adcc9b2a58ad019a2d16b669483e5780680244
spent
true